Latest Patents
Seto holds a patent for a substrate having a built-in capacitor and the process for producing the same. This substrate incorporates an insulator and features a capacitor with a dielectric layer made of a silicon nitride-based ceramic. This ceramic contains silicon carbide in an amount ranging from 13 to 30% by weight. His patent represents a significant advancement in the field of electronic components.
